Base of the Pyramid Strategy

The base of the economic pyramid, or the 4 billion people that live on less than $4 a day, represent a massive market for companies to serve: there is a huge and growing profit potential for providing the base of the economic pyramid high-quality, life-enhancing goods and service at a low price point but at a high volume.

Microfinance

Microfinance refers to the provision of financial services to the poor to help grow small businesses or fund productive activities. It includes microcredit, microsavings, and microinsurance. As suggested by the name, the majority of transactions are in small denominations, frequently less than 100 USD.

Socially Responsible Investing

Socially Responsible Investing (SRI) is an investment strategy that integrates social or environmental criteria into financial analysis. SRI has gained momentum in recent years because SRI helps investors achieve at least 3 goals:

  • Align their investment portfolio with their personal values by avoiding companies that do not meet certain standards.
  • Encourage improved corporate social and environmental performance through an active investment strategy.
  • Identify companies with better long-term financial performance through the analysis of social and environmental factors.
